選擇題 (40)
1. Lithium forms compounds which are used in dry cells and storage batteries and in high-temperature
lubricants. It has two naturally occurring isotopes, 6Li (isotopic mass = 6.015121 amu) and 7Li (isotopic
mass = 7.016003 amu). Lithium has an atomic mass of 6.9409 amu. What is the percent abundance of
lithium-6?
(A) 92.50% (B) 86.66% (C) 46.16% (D) 7.503% (E) 6.080%
2. Vinegar is a solution of acetic acid, CH3COOH, dissolved in water. A 5.54g sample of vinegar was
neutralized by 30.10 mL of 0.100 M NaOH. What is the percent by weight of acetic acid in the vinegar?
(A) 0.184% (B) 1.63% (C) 3.26% (D) 5.43% (E) 9.23%
3. Based on the solubility rules, which of the following will occur if solutions of CuSO4(aq) and BaCl2(aq)
are mixed?
(A) CuCl2 will precipitate; Ba2+ and SO42 – are spectator ions.
(B) CuSO4 will precipitate; Ba2+ and Cl – are spectator ions.
(C) BaSO4 will precipitate; Cu2+ and Cl– are spectator ions.
(D) BaCl2 will precipitate; Cu2+ and SO42 – are spectator ions.
(E) No precipitate will form.
4. Which of the following is a strong acid?
(A) HF (B) KOH (C) HClO4 (D) HClO (E) HBrO
5. Which of the following is a correct set of quantum numbers for an electron in a 3d orbital?
(A) n = 3, l = 0, ml = -1 (B) n = 3, l = 1, ml = +3 (C) n = 3, l = 3, ml = +2
(D) n = 3, l = 2, ml = -2 (E) n = 3, l = 2, ml = 3
6. An atom of vanadium has ___ unpaired electrons and is _____.
(A) 0, diamagnetic (B) 2, diamagnetic (C) 3, paramagnetic
(D) 5, paramagnetic (E) 4, diamagnetic
7. The small, but important, energy differences between 3s, 3p, and 3d orbitals are due mainly to
(A) the number of electrons they can hold (B) their principal quantum number
(C) the Heisenberg uncertainty principle (D) the penetration effect
(E) Hund's rule
8. Select the correct electron configuration for Cu (Z = 29).
(A) [Ar]4s23d9 (B) [Ar]4s13d10 (C) [Ar]4s24p63d3 (D) [Ar]4s24d9
(E) [Ar]5s24d9
9. Consider the set of isoelectronic atoms and ions A2-, B-, C, D+, and E2+. Which arrangement of relative
radii is correct?
(A) A2- > B- > C > D+ > E2+ (B) E2+ > D+ > C > B- > A2-
(C) A2- > B- > C < D+ < E2+ (D) A2- < B- < C > D+ > E2+
(E) None of these is correct.
10. If a molecule demonstrates paramagnetism, then :
I. The substance can have both paired and unpaired electrons.
II. The bond order is not a whole number.
III. It can be determined by drawing a Lewis structure.
IV. It must be an ion.
(A)I, II (B) I, II, IV (C) II, III (D) I only (E) All of the above are correct.
11. Predict the ideal bond angles around nitrogen in N2F2 using the molecular shape given by the VSEPR
theory. (N is the central atom.)
(A) 90° (B) 109° (C) 120° (D) 180° (E) between 120 and 180°
12. Which of the following molecules has a net dipole moment?
(A) BeCl2 (B) SF2 (C) KrF2 (D) CO2 (E) CCl4
13. Valence bond theory predicts that xenon will use _____ hybrid orbitals in XeOF4.
(A) sp (B) sp2 (C) sp3 (D) sp3d (E) sp3d2
14. According to molecular orbital (MO) theory, the twelve outermost electrons in the O2 molecule are
distributed as follows:
(A) 12 in bonding MOs, 0 in antibonding MOs.
(B) 10 in bonding MOs, 2 in antibonding MOs.
(C) 9 in bonding MOs, 3 in antibonding MOs.
(D) 8 in bonding MOs, 4 in antibonding MOs.
(E) 7 in bonding MOs, 5 in antibonding MOs.
15. Which of the following statements relating to molecular orbital (MO) theory is incorrect?
(A) Combination of two atomic orbitals produces one bonding and one antibonding MO.
(B) A bonding MO is lower in energy than the two atomic orbitals from which it is formed.
(C) Combination of two 2p orbitals may result in either σ or π MOs.
(D) A species with a bond order of zero will not be stable.
(E) In a stable molecule having an even number of electrons, all electrons must be paired.

16. One can safely assume that the 3s- and 3p-orbitals will form molecular orbitals similar to those formed
when 2s- and 2p-orbitals interact. According to molecular orbital theory, what will be the bond order
for the Cl2+ ion?
(A) 0.5 (B) 1 (C) 1.5 (D) 2 (E) None of these choices is correct.
17. Consider three 1-L flasks at STP. Flask A contains NH3 gas, flask B contains NO2 gas, and flask C
contains N2 gas. Which contains the largest number of molecules?
(A) Flask A (B) Flask B (C) Flask C (D) All are the same (E) None of these choices is
correct.
18. In which flask are the molecules least polar and therefore most ideal in behavior?
(A) Flask A (B) Flask B (C) Flask C (D) All are the same (E) None of these choices is
correct.
19. For which of the following species are the intermolecular interactions entirely due to dispersion forces?
(A) C2H6 (B) CH3OCH3 (C) NO2 (D) H2S
20. Which of the following liquids would have the highest viscosity at 25°C?
(A) CH3OCH3 (B) C2H5OH (C) CH3Br (D) HOCH2CH2OH
21. A 15.00 % by mass solution of lactose (C12H22O11, 342.30 g/mol) in water has a density of 1.0602 g/mL
at 20°C. What is the molarity of this solution?
(A) 0.03097 M (B) 0.4133 M (C) 0.4646 M (D) 1.590 M (E) 1.379 M
22. Which of the following systems possesses the lowest freezing point?
(A) 0.1 M FeCl3(aq) (B) 0.1 M K2SO4(aq) (C) 0.1 M CaCl2(aq) (D) 0.3 M C6H12O6, glucose
(E) 0.1 M NaCl
23. For a particular process q = 20 kJ and w = 15 kJ. Which of the following statements is true?
(A) Heat flows from the system to the surroundings.
(B) The system does work on the surroundings.
(C) E = 35 kJ (D) All of the above are true. (E) None of these choices is correct.
24. Which of the following results in a decrease in the entropy of the system?
(A) O2(g), 300 KO2(g), 400 K
(B) H2O(s), 0°C H2O(l), 0°C
(C) N2(g), 25°CN2(aq), 25°C
(D) NH3(l), -34.5°C NH3(g), -34.5°C
(E) 2H2O2(g) 2H2O(g) + O2(g)
25. Given the following acids and Ka values:
HClO4 HOAc HCN HF
1 107 1.76 10–5 4.93 10–10 3.53 10–4
What is the order of increasing base strength?
(A) CN–, F–, OAc–, ClO4– (B) CN–, OAc–, F–, ClO4– (C) CN–, ClO4–, F–, OAc–
(D) ClO4–, OAc–, CN–, F– (E) ClO4–, F–, OAc–, CN–
26. According to the first law of thermodynamics, the energy of the universe is constant. Does this mean
that ΔE is always equal to zero?
(A) Yes, ΔE = 0 at all times, which is why q = -w.
(B) No, ΔE does not always equal zero, but this is only due to factors like friction and heat.
(C) No, ΔE does not always equal zero because it refers to the system's internal energy, which is
affected by heat and work.
(D) No, ΔE never equals zero because work is always being done on the system or by the system.
(E) None of these
27. Calculate the pH of the following aqueous solution: 0.66 M NaF (pKa for HF = 3.14)
(A) 5.52 (B) 2.96 (C) 8.48 (D) 11.04 (E) none of these
28. Colligative properties depend on
(A) the chemical properties of the solute. (B) the chemical properties of the solvent.
(C) the masses of the individual ions. (D) the molar mass of the solute.
(E) the number of particles dissolved.
29. A 0.100 m K2SO4 solution has a freezing point of -0.43°C. What is the van't Hoff factor for this solution?
Kf = 1.86°C/m
(A) 0.77 (B) 1.0 (C) 2.3 (D) 3.0 (E) >3.0
30. The reaction 2A + 5B → products is second order in A and fourth order in B. What is the rate law for
this reaction?
(A) rate = k[A]2[B]5 (B) rate = k[A]4[B]2 (C) rate = k[A]2[B]4
(D) rate = k[A]5[B]2 (E) rate = k[A]2/7[B]5/7
31. The Ksp of AgI is 1.5 ൈ 10–16. Calculate the solubility in mol/L of AgI in a 0.45 M NaI solution.
(A)6.8ൈ10–17 (B) 0.45 (C) 1.5ൈ10–16 (D) 1.2ൈ10–8 (E) 3.3ൈ10–16
32. What is the formula for the pentaamminehydroxotitanium(II) ion?
(A)[Ti(NH3)(OH)5]3– (B) [Ti(NH3)5(OH)5]2+ (C) [Ti(NH3)5(OH)]2+ (D)[Ti(NH3)5(OH)5]3–
(E) [Ti(NH3)5(OH)]+

33. Which of the following complexes can exhibit optical isomerism? (en = H2N–CH2–CH2–NH2 and is
bidentate)
(A)cis–Co(NH3)4Cl2 (B) trans–Co(en)2Br2 (C) cis–Co(en)2Cl2 (D) Co(NH3)3Cl3
(E) none of these
34. Which of the following complexes shows geometrical isomerism?
(A) [Co(NH3)5Cl]SO4 (B) [Co(NH3)6]Cl3 (C) [Co(NH3)5Cl]Cl2 (D) K[Co(NH3)2Cl4]
(E) none of these
35. The complex ions of Zn2+ are all colorless. The most likely explanation for this is:
(A) Zn2+ is paramagnetic.
(B) Zn2+ exhibits “d orbital” splittings in its complexes such that they absorb all wavelengths in the
visible region.
(C) Since Zn2+ is a d10 ion, it does not absorb visible light even though the “d orbital” splittings are
correct for absorbing visible wavelengths.
(D) Zn2+ is not a transition metal ion.
(E) None of these is correct.
36. The complex FeL62+, where L is a neutral ligand, is known to be diamagnetic. The number of d
electrons in this complex ion is:
(A)4 (B) 5 (C) 6 (D) 7 (E) 8
37. What is the correct IUPAC name for [MnCl4(H2O)2]– ?
(A) diaquatetrachloromanganate(0) ion (B) diaquatetrachloromanganate(III) ion
(C) diaquatetrachloromanganate(I) ion (D) diaquatetrachloromanganese(III) ion
(E) diaquatetrachloromanganese(I) ion
38. What is the maximum oxidation state expected for titanium?
(A)+8 (B) +5 (C) +3 (D) +2 (E) +4
39. Consider the following numbered processes:ΔH for the process A → 2C + E is
1. A→2B
2. B →C + D
3. E → 2D
(A) ΔH1+ΔH2 +ΔH3 (B) ΔH1+ΔH2 (C) ΔH1+ΔH2 –ΔH3
(D) ΔH1 + 2ΔH2 –ΔH3 (E) none of these
40. Which of the following species has the largest dissociation energy?
(A)O2 (B) O2– (C) O22– (D) O2+ (E) O22+ 3
